Story

Behind SPAD?

Time is mysterious and sometimes extraordinary ideas are conceived in the most ordinary moments. One such beautiful thing happened in the year 1995 when Dr. Rishi Shukla shared his intent with his family & friends that he wants to help patients in understanding diabetes, so that they can manage their disease in an orderly way.

The idea was very well welcomed by the peer group and in that very first meeting it was acted upon. Thus the name SPAD (Society for Prevention and Awareness of Diabetes) took its first breath.

SPAD has been conducting Diabetes Awareness Programme on the 4th Sunday of Every Month since 1995. Not a single fourth-Sunday has been missed!

After SPAD was formed in 1995 the core group committee under the efficient leadership of Dr. Rishi Shukla decided to dedicate a day of the month where-in the diabetes education / awareness programme will be conducted for Type-2 patients. It was unanimously decided that 4th Sunday will be allotted for this and every member will make himself / herself available for this cause.

It has been more than 25 years this “Regular Meeting of SPAD” has been going on with out any interruption. Infact it is first programme in India which has continued for so long and the journey is still going-on.
